wwww
Révision | e02ae4965f0f1925c9f258d14abf9a3a6e938f4d (tree) |
---|---|
l'heure | 2016-05-09 07:06:46 |
Auteur | sparky4 <sparky4@cock...> |
Commiter | sparky4 |
w
@@ -92,6 +92,9 @@ void modexEnter(sword vq, boolean cmem, global_game_variables_t *gv) | ||
92 | 92 | { |
93 | 93 | case 1: |
94 | 94 | //CRTParmCount = sizeof(ModeX_320x240regs) / sizeof(ModeX_320x240regs[0]); |
95 | + /*for(i=0; i<CRTParmCount; i++) { | |
96 | + outpw(CRTC_INDEX, ModeX_320x240regs[i]); | |
97 | + }*/ | |
95 | 98 | /* width and height */ |
96 | 99 | gv->video.page[0].sw = vga_state.vga_width = 320; // VGA lib currently does not update this |
97 | 100 | gv->video.page[0].sh = vga_state.vga_height = 240; // VGA lib currently does not update this |
@@ -31,7 +31,7 @@ | ||
31 | 31 | #include "src/lib/modex16/16planar.h" |
32 | 32 | #include "src/lib/16text.h" |
33 | 33 | #include "src/lib/modex16/16render.h" |
34 | -// #include "src/lib/modex16/320x240.h" | |
34 | +#include "src/lib/modex16/320x240.h" | |
35 | 35 | // #include "src/lib/modex16/320x200.h" |
36 | 36 | // #include "src/lib/modex16/256x192.h" |
37 | 37 | // #include "src/lib/modex16/192x144_.h" |
@@ -99,7 +99,7 @@ void main(int argc, char *argv[]) | ||
99 | 99 | |
100 | 100 | /* fill the page with one color, but with a black border */ |
101 | 101 | modexShowPage(&gvar.video.page[1]); |
102 | - //modexClearRegion(&gvar.video.page[0], 0, 0, gvar.video.page[0].width, gvar.video.page[0].height, 0); | |
102 | + modexClearRegion(&gvar.video.page[0], 0, 0, gvar.video.page[0].width, gvar.video.page[0].height, 15); | |
103 | 103 | modexClearRegion(&gvar.video.page[0], 16, 16, gvar.video.page[0].sw, gvar.video.page[0].sh, 128); |
104 | 104 | modexClearRegion(&gvar.video.page[0], 32, 32, gvar.video.page[0].sw-32, gvar.video.page[0].sh-32, 42); |
105 | 105 | modexClearRegion(&gvar.video.page[0], 48, 48, gvar.video.page[0].sw-64, gvar.video.page[0].sh-64, 128); |
@@ -109,7 +109,7 @@ void main(int argc, char *argv[]) | ||
109 | 109 | /* fade in */ |
110 | 110 | modexFadeOn(1, pal2); |
111 | 111 | |
112 | - i=0,k=0,j=0,pan.pn=0; | |
112 | + i=0,k=0,j=0,pan.pn=1; | |
113 | 113 | startclk = *clockw; |
114 | 114 | while(!IN_KeyDown(sc_Escape)) |
115 | 115 | { |
@@ -149,7 +149,10 @@ void main(int argc, char *argv[]) | ||
149 | 149 | baka: |
150 | 150 | i++; |
151 | 151 | modexClearRegion(&gvar.video.page[1], 0, gvar.video.page[0].height/2, gvar.video.page[0].width-32, 16, 45);*/ |
152 | - if(IN_KeyDown(6)) modexClearRegion(&gvar.video.page[1], 0, gvar.video.page[0].height/2, gvar.video.page[0].width, 16, 45); | |
152 | + if(IN_KeyDown(6)) | |
153 | + { | |
154 | + modexClearRegion(&gvar.video.page[1], gvar.video.page[1].sw, 16, 8, 4, 45); | |
155 | + } | |
153 | 156 | if(IN_KeyDown(4+1)){ |
154 | 157 | modexClearRegion(&gvar.video.page[1], 16, 16, gvar.video.page[1].sw, gvar.video.page[1].sh, 128); |
155 | 158 | modexClearRegion(&gvar.video.page[1], 32, 32, gvar.video.page[1].sw-32, gvar.video.page[1].sh-32, 42); |
@@ -158,7 +161,9 @@ void main(int argc, char *argv[]) | ||
158 | 161 | //} |
159 | 162 | if(IN_KeyDown(2)) pan.pn=0; |
160 | 163 | if(IN_KeyDown(3)) pan.pn=1; |
161 | - //if(IN_KeyDown(6)) modexClearRegion(&gvar.video.page[1], 0, 0, gvar.video.page[0].sw-64, gvar.video.page[0].sh-16, 45); | |
164 | + if(IN_KeyDown(25)){ | |
165 | + modexpdump(&gvar.video.page[pan.pn]); | |
166 | + }//p | |
162 | 167 | modexShowPage(&gvar.video.page[pan.pn]); |
163 | 168 | } |
164 | 169 |